Greetings All: Steve Collins and Peter Keyel located and photographed a Slate-throated Redstart at Stanford Park in Plains (Yoakum County) this morning. It was, at the time in the main loop of the park - just downstream from B Street and 5th Street. Other birds present include 1 Tennessee Warbler, 1 Black-throated Gray Warbler, and multiple Townsend's Warblers. The redstart was hanging out on its own. This park is long - in theory it can be walked (though one has to cross roads and dodge some housing) all the way downstream to Highway 214. When this park is good, it is very good and it is worth working the whole length. Anthony 'Fat Tony' Hewetson; Lubbock
